MOSCOW. June 14 (Interfax) - Russian President Vladimir Putin has no "excessive expectations" from outcomes of the upcoming presidential elections in the United States, presidential aide Yury Ushakov said.
Journalists asked Ushakov on Wednesday to comment on High Representative of the EU for Foreign Affairs and Security Policy and European Commission Vice President Josep Borrell's remark that no negotiations on Ukraine would begin before the U.S. presidential elections and that the Russian president was waiting to see its outcomes.
"They [outcomes of presidential elections in the U.S.] are certainly of interest [to Putin], as well as to any normal person. But there are no excessive expectations," Ushakov said.
